Cromwell, Connecticut, offers a variety of outdoor activities and family-friendly attractions that cater to all ages. One of the most popular spots for locals and visitors alike is the Cromwell Park, which features playgrounds, sports fields, and walking trails. Families can enjoy picnicking in the open green spaces while children can play safely on the well-maintained equipment. The park is a great place to spend a sunny afternoon, allowing for both relaxation and active play.
For those who enjoy nature, the nearby Wethersfield Cove is just a short drive away, approximately ten minutes from Cromwell. This scenic area is perfect for leisurely walks along the water or birdwatching, offering a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le of daily life. The cove is part of the larger Connecticut River, where families can observe various wildlife and appreciate the natural beauty of the region.
Another excellent outdoor option is the nearby Great Meadows Marsh, located about 15 minutes from Cromwell. This state-owned wildlife refuge is ideal for hiking and exploring the wetlands. Families can take advantage of the trails that wind through the marsh, providing opportunities for spotting birds and other wildlife. The peaceful environment makes it a suitable spot for a nature walk or a family outing.

For a fun day out, head to the nearby Middletown, which is approximately 15 minutes away. In Middletown, families can explore the beautiful parks along the Connecticut River, such as Harbor Park, where you can enjoy walking paths, picnic areas, and scenic views. The park is perfect for a family stroll or a relaxing afternoon by the water.
During the winter months, families can take advantage of the nearby Powder Ridge Mountain Park, located about 30 minutes from Cromwell. This ski resort offers winter sports activities such as skiing, snowboarding, and tubing, providing fun for the entire family. It’s a great way to embrace the season and enjoy the outdoors together.
